View all productsWhat activated B complex usually means
On a supplement label, activated often refers to forms such as methylfolate, methylcobalamin, or P5P. These names can look technical, but the practical point is simple: the formula is positioned as a more advanced version of a standard B complex.
Many people look for this style when they want a more specific formula or when they have already tried a basic B complex and want to compare a higher specification option.
What to compare across active form blends
Look at which active forms are included, the overall potency, the daily serving size, and whether the formula stays focused on B vitamins or adds extra ingredients for stress and mood support.
You may also notice delivery differences such as liposomal formats. These can be useful to compare, but they are best treated as one part of the product story rather than the only factor that matters.

Common questions
What is an activated B complex?
It is a B complex formula that usually highlights active forms of certain B vitamins, rather than a more conventional everyday blend.
Does activated mean better for everyone?
Not necessarily. It usually means the formula has a different specification and positioning. The best fit depends on what you want from the product and how the label compares with other options.
What should I compare before buying?
Start with the exact active forms used, the serving size, the strength of the formula, and whether the product is a simple B complex or a more premium blend with extra delivery or support features.
